Overview




The Construction Laborer is responsible for performing tasks involving physical labor at FNF Construction projects. The Construction Laborer will be proficient in operating hand and power tools of all types. The Construction Laborer will have proven general construction experience and the ability to thoroughly understand and follow directions provided by the Project Superintendent. The Construction Laborer should also have the ability to read basic design documents, specifications and be familiar with Arizona Code requirements associated with the assigned installations.






Responsibilities




Other skills and responsibilities include, but are not limited to the following:

    General understanding of subcontractors' scope of work
  • OSHA 30 Certification and safety enforcement
  • Proficient and skilled in the use of common construction tools (i.e. hand drill, grinder, nail gun, skill saw, sander, chain hoist, line level, spray guns, jackhammer, compactor, etc.)
  • Knowledge of schedule and productivity requirements associated with completing work activities
  • Ability to mix, place and finish concrete
  • Ability to support asphalt installation (sub base, compaction, butt joints, etc.)
  • Provide labor associated with hand excavation and installation of side supports
  • Provide labor and support in the erection of scaffolding as required
  • Identify and correct potential hazards and safety issues with required labor
  • Provide labor in the demolition of existing structures in a safe and efficient manner
  • Support the Project Superintendent in completing the Daily Log Reports (Procore)
  • Support the Project Superintendent during quality inspections
  • Inspect work ensuring quality installations per drawings
  • Provide the labor for the surveyor and the setting of control points, bench marks and batter boards
  • Perform site clean-up and housekeeping as required and as directed by the Project Superintendent
  • Provide labor in the unloading and loading of construction materials and equipment





Qualifications




  • OSHA 30 Certification - In depth knowledge of OSHA safety standards and procedures.
  • Ability to work independently and complete daily activities according to the work schedule.
  • Ability to lift heavy objects, walk and stand for long periods of time and perform strenuous physical labor under adverse field conditions.
  • Ability to use and operate tools and equipment in a safe manner.
  • Ability to communicate orally and in writing - English and Spanish preferred.
  • Ability to understand, follow and transmit written and oral instructions.
  • Ability to attend and contribute to construction coordination meetings and safety meetings.
  • Consistent and dependable attendance to work schedule.
  • Ability to work overtime as directed.
